Coffee vending machine
Provided is a coffee vending machine including: a plurality of capsule stacking parts arranged in a lattice form to stack capsules therein in a first direction, a capsule feeding unit disposed at the centers of the bottoms of the capsule stacking parts to feed the capsules quantitatively, a coffee brewing part for seating the capsule fed from the capsule feeding unit, feeding water to the capsule, and brewing coffee to be provided for a consumer, and a cup discharging part for discharging a cup in which the coffee is contained to the outside. The coffee brewing part allows the capsule to be seated onto a seating groove when first and second portion seating parts are adjacent thereto or contacted with each other and allows the capsule to be freely fallen through a space formed between the first and second portion seating parts when they are spaced apart from each other.
Locking brewing device, beverage brewing device and beverage machine
A locking brewing device includes a seat body configured to mount a material cup and including a piston chamber with an open end and a closed end, a piston slidably and sealedly arranged in the piston chamber and configured to lock a beverage capsule in the material cup, and a liquid guide piercing tube arranged at a surface of the piston that faces the open end of the piston chamber and being configured to pierce the beverage capsule in the material cup and deliver liquid. The piston and the closed end of the piston chamber form a pressure medium chamber having an opening, and the piston includes a liquid inlet passage in communication with the liquid guide piercing tube.
MULTIPLE DOSING DEVICE AND MAGAZINE
The present disclosure concerns a multiple dosing device and magazine for releasing one or more doses of additive. The multiple dosing device comprises a magazine having a number of through openings, each receiving a tube, containing a dose of additive. The through openings and tubes (2) extended axially between two opposite ends of the magazine. The tubes are arranged moveable in an axial direction inside respective through opening. Each tube has a pointed lower end. An upper foil and a lower foil are placed adhered to the opposite ends of the magazine. The ends of the tubes are placed abutting or adjacent the upper and lower foils, respectively. The multiple dosing device further comprises an activation part with push buttons, which push buttons are placed for controlling the axial position of one tube each.
Magazine for capsules
The invention relates to a magazine unit for fitting a brewing device with a portion capsule. The magazine has a storage magazine for storing portion capsules, said portion capsules being stacked one after the other in a stacking direction, and the magazine unit has a transporting means for transporting a portion capsule out of the storage magazine into the brewing device. The transporting means can be pivoted about a pivot axis between a removal position for removing the portion capsule from the storage magazine and a dispensing position for fitting the brewing device with the portion capsule, said pivot axis being perpendicular to the stacking direction.
Inter-Operable Capsule Dispensing Unit and Beverage Preparation Machine
A beverage preparation system comprising: a capsule dispenser to dispense a capsule to a user as a dispensing operation; a beverage preparation machine to extract an ingredient of a beverage from a capsule supplied thereto by a user as a beverage preparation operation, the capsule dispenser and beverage preparation machine being operatively linked by a control system, the control system being configured to: obtain dispensing information for determining a dispensing count, which comprises a running count of the capsule dispensing operations; obtain beverage preparation information for determining a beverage preparation count, which comprises a running count of the beverage preparation operations; wherein the control system is configured to disable a subsequent beverage preparation operation if the dispensing count is less than or equal to beverage preparation count or if the dispensing count is less than beverage preparation count by more than a first predetermined amount.

CAPSULE DISTRIBUTING DEVICE WITH BULK LOADING
Disclosed is a device for distributing capsules with axial symmetry and irregular shape, including: a container apt to receive in bulk a plurality of capsules; an ordering assembly placed inside the container, apt to arrange the capsules vertically; an orientating assembly, apt to receive the capsules from the ordering assembly and to orientate them in a predetermined direction; and a conveying assembly apt to receive the capsules from the orientating assembly and to convey them towards a distribution outlet in a predetermined orientation.
Pod dispenser
A dispenser (1) of pods (2) for the production of brewed beverages; the dispenser (1) is equipped with a magazine (4) for holding pods (2) arranged in random order, a belt conveyor (9) designed to extract the pods (2) one by one from the storage compartment (4) to feed then to an outlet (16) in a feed direction (15), and an agitator device (10), which cooperates with the conveyor (9) to move pods (2) away from the conveyor (9) and is defined by a rotor having a hub (24), which is rotationally mounted about an axis (25) transversal to the feed direction (15) to rotate in the opposite direction to the belt conveyor (9), and blades (26), which, during rotation, define with the belt conveyor (9) and upstream of the outlet (16), a gap (28) designed to allow pods (2) lying flat on the belt (11) of the conveyor (9) to reach the outlet (16).
FRONT LOADING BEVERAGE MAKING SYSTEMS AND METHODS
A drawer assembly for a capsule based brewing machine includes a housing having at least a one track on an inner side thereof. The drawer assembly includes a platform located within the housing for positioning a capsule puncturing needle. The drawer assembly includes a drawer. The drawer having at least one capsule receptacle therein, slidably engaged with the track of the housing. A method of operating drawer assembly for a capsule based brewing machine includes translating a drawer along a track of a housing from an extracted position to an inserted position, changing a vertical distance between a top surface of the drawer and a lower surface of a platform, and puncturing a capsule with a puncturing needle.
